The college is housed in a spacious new building constructed as per norms and specifications of AICTE and Council of Architecture. Our infrastructure is thoughtfully designed to support both academic learning and professional development in architecture and design.
5 spacious studios for a minimum of 40 students each, fully equipped with drawing board desks.
4 separate classrooms dedicated to lectures, seminars and theoretical studies.
Over 1,000 titles with monthly new issues and a large reading hall for independent study.
Presentation cum seminar hall with overhead projector and a separate dedicated LCD projector hall.
Art studio, workshop with model making room, carpentry tools, material museum and construction yard.
Surveying and levelling instruments, meteorological instruments and masonry tools for hands-on learning.
A covered courtyard for group activities, gatherings and cultural events throughout the year.
Assembly hall and playground shared with other institutions on the Azam Campus.
Canteen, Nescafé outlet and adequate parking space to ensure a comfortable campus experience.
